The ability to extrapolate out from the spectral data into molecular information depends on some mathematical relations that begin with classical mechanics and are brought into the quantum mechanical field through some manipulation. This change in vibrational energy (ν=0 to ν=1) with several different rotational energy changes (J=±1) leads to the splitting in a typical ro-vibrational spectrum shown in Figure 2. When applied to the quantized levels of quantum mechanical concepts, the energy of the vibration is found via equation 8: Where  is Planck’s constant, νe is the harmonic frequency, and ν is the vibrational quantum number, with ν = 0,1,2,3, . Valence shell electron-pair repulsion theory (VSEPR theory) enables us to predict the molecular structure, including approximate bond angles around a central atom, of a molecule from an examination of the number of bonds and lone electron pairs in its Lewis structure.
